Neonatal and Pediatric Respiratory Care, 5th Edition gives you a solid foundation in the assessment and treatment of respiratory disorders. Clear, full-color coverage simplifies the principles of respiratory care while emphasizing clinical application. A critical piece in respiratory care's total curriculum solution, this new edition includes all the changes in current clinical practice and in the education environment. Learning objectives at the beginning of each chapter break down key content into measurable behaviors, criteria, and conditions, and self-assessment questions provide an excellent review for the NBRC Neonatal/Pediatric Specialty exam. 0aPediatric respiratory diseases. 0aPerinatology.12aRespiratory Tract Diseasesxtherapy.22aInfant, Newborn.22aChild.22aRespiratory Tract Diseasesxdiagnosis.22aRespiratory Therapyxmethods.22aFetal Developmentxphysiology. 7aPediatric respiratory diseases.2fast0(OCoLC)fst01056480 7aPerinatology.2fast0(OCoLC)fst010580411 aWalsh, Brian K.,eeditor. a7bcbccpccadapd2encipf20gy-gencatlg 2lcccBKe5th ed c4110d4110 00102lcc4070aH0713bH0713cREFd2021-03-26eInstitiutionalg6795.75iI-2104-6-073634l0oRJ431 .P47 2019r2021-04-20 00:00:00v6795.75w2021-04-20yBK
